Ingredients of Baked meatless tacos (with fresh salsa)

  1. Prepare 4 of large Flour Tortillas.
  2. It's 1 of can Black Beans, drained but not rinsed.
  3. It's 2 of large cloves Garlic, chopped.
  4. You need 16 of oz. Ricotta Cheese.
  5. You need 1/3 of cup grated Parmesan Cheese.
  6. Prepare of For the Salsa.
  7. It's 2 of large ripe Tomatoes, diced.
  8. You need 1 of med. Sweet Onion diced.
  9. You need 1 of large clove Garlic, chopped fine.
  10. It's 2 of Jalapeño peppers, minced.
  11. Prepare 1 of tsp. dried Cilantro.
  12. It's 1 of tsp. dried Oregano.
  13. You need 1 of pinch Salt.
  14. Prepare 1 of tbs. Lemon juice.

Baked meatless tacos (with fresh salsa) step by step

  1. Mix your salsa and refrigerate at least 1 hour..
  2. Mash the beans with the garlic..
  3. Mix the cheeses..
  4. Place 1/4 of beans on half tortilla, top with 1/4 of cheese mix. Spread to edge, fold over. Repeat..
  5. Place filled tortillas on greased cookie sheet. Bake at 350° for approx. 25 minutes or until slightly browned..
  6. Serve with salsa..
